Camp Cook and General Labourer
As a Camp Cook and General labourer at Black Moose Outposts, you will assist the Resort Manager in providing exceptional culinary and hospitality services to our clients. Your key role will include planning and cooking meals for guests at remote outposts, procurement of products, inventory control, food safety and sanitation, setting up and serving guest their daily meals, and catering to guests’ general hospitality needs and preferences. Additionally, you will participate in minor maintenance, cleaning and property upkeep tasks as needed

Key Responsibilities
- Meal Planning, Preparation and Service: Assist with menu planning and procurement, execute daily set up, preparation, and service of guest meals, and be responsible for inventory control, food safety, sanitation, cleaning of work and serving areas, and overall guest hospitality satisfaction at the outpost.
- General labourer work & Maintenance: Participate in minor camp and equipment maintenance, and general property upkeep as needed.
- Assistance with supplies and luggage transport: Help with loading and unloading various goods, being transported to the outpost by the floatplane.
- Collaboration: Work alongside Housekeepers and Pilots, for efficient property upkeep, loading and unloading of supplies, luggage, and equipment.
- Travel Flexibility: Fly to, and stay at, various remote outposts as needed, to conduct key culinary and hospitality responsibilities and assist with general laborer tasks.

Additional Information:
- Accommodation: Living accommodations at the outposts are provided.
- Seasonal Position: During the fishing and hunting season – May through October.
- Location: Red Lake, (Northwestern) Ontario, Canada.
- Travel and Stay: Floatplane flights to stay at our various outposts for at least a week at a time.
